Husband's advice on weight
The snaps come after her toyboy husband Tom Kaulitz, 36, told her to embrace her "fuller figure" after she went through menopause. Recalling his advice, she explained: "I think with age, we look better when we’re not as skinny. My husband was the first one who pointed that out. He said, 'You should eat more; you would look better if you had more meat on your bones.'" While the comment may come off as brash to many, Heidi claimed she respected his opinion — even agreeing with him. She explained Tom's advice was "not something you’re told in the industry, ever, because you’re always supposed to be skinnier than you are." She added: "When I look back at photos, I’m like, 'He’s right!' Proportion-wise, I look better bigger. I’ve gained weight over the years. I’m no longer a size 24 jean." Heidi also shunned any use of weight loss drugs to help shed pounds. Speaking plainly about the use of drugs such as Ozempic to lose weight, she hit back: "I'm not interested at all."
